I went from a pair of B&W 703s (older nicer version of the Cm9) to a pair of Thiel 2.4CS and the improvement was staggering. 

what I learned is that the 703s is just a bad speaker, not really good at anything and the Thiels are over achievers and a lot more money needs to be spent to better them. If you don't mind owning a discounted model the thiel 2.4cs is a steal on the used market right now at around $2000ish. They were $6,500 at the end of their cycle.
